=Oakland Tribune=
===1892===
* 1892-2-24: "Gospel Hall, 475 Sixth Street... special meetings will be held in the above hall beginning on Monday, 22d instant and continuing until further notice, every night during the week except Saturday, at 7:45; conducted by Donald MonroMunro, Evangelist from Toronto, Canada, Charles Montgomery and others; the object of these meetings being the reading and exposition of God's Blessed Word in the edification and consequent revival of his people in Oakland, who are cordially invited; on Monday all day meeting 10 A.M.; seats all free and no collections; bring your Bibles."
* 1892-3-5: "Gospel Hall... Lord's supper 11 A.M.; address to Christians by D. Munro, evangelist, at 3:50 P.M., and preaching of the gospel at 7:30 P.M."
* 1902-1-25: "Gospel Hall, southwest corner Broadway and Eighth street (entrance on Eighth): William J. McClure, the Irish evangelist, will preach Sunday evening at 7:30, subject, "Christ and Him Crucified." Seats free. No collections. Bring your Bibles."
* 1902-1-25: "Gospel Hall, Twenty-third avenue, near depot: Wm. J. McClure, the Irish evangelist, will deliver an address to Christians at 3:00 P.M. Seats free. No collections. Bring your Bibles."
 
* 1902-4-26: "Gospel Hall, 453 Eighth street, corner Broadway: T.H. Hill, from central Africa, will preach in the above named hall at 7:30 P.M. Subject: "Christ and Him Crucified". All welcome."
* 1902-11-22: "Gospel Hall, 453 Eighth street, corner Broadway: Christians gathered to the name of the Lord Jesus Christ. Breaking of Bread, 11 a.m.; Sunday School, 12:30 a.m.; Gospel preaching, 7:30 p.m."
===1905===
* 1905-2-18: "Brethren Gospel Hall, 1064 Market street, near Twelfth: Donald MonroeMunro, evangelist, of Toronto, [[Canada]], will give an address to Christians at 3 p.m. and preach the gospel at 7:30 p.m."
* 1905-3-18: "Gospel Hall: Mr. E. Haek, evangelist from [[New York]], well known as a Bible carriage worker all over [[England]], [[Scotland]] and Ireland will preach on Sunday at 3 p.m. in the Gospel Hall, Twelfth and Market streets, Oakland. All are cordially invited."
* 1905-4-29: "At Gospel Hall, 1100 Twenty-third avenue, opposite railroad station. Evangelist Edward Stack of [[New York]] will commence meetings on Sunday, April 30, at 7:45 p.m. No collections.
